Atos Legacy Atos Engaged Employee Experience Employee Experience, Employee Engagement HCM n/a 2025 2025 In 2025 the Department For Environment Food And Rural Affairs United Kingdom engaged Atos under a £150m five year contract to provision Atos Engaged Employee Experience, addressing Employee Experience,Employee Engagement for IT and end user services across the department. The contract covers a transformation of service desk and digital workplace capabilities for roughly 34,000 colleagues across the UK, and the engagement is explicitly focused on improving service quality, agility and environmental sustainability. Atos Engaged Employee Experience is being deployed as an end user services and service desk platform with embedded AI and machine learning for analytics driven incident handling, and with sustainable device lifecycle practices incorporated into operational design. Functional capabilities implemented include centralized service desk workflows, digital workplace provisioning and support, analytics instrumentation for service quality monitoring, and device lifecycle management processes that prioritize sustainability. Operational coverage is limited to DEFRA s UK footprint and targets IT and end user service functions within the department, aligning the application with public sector digital workplace requirements. Integrations will be oriented toward existing IT and digital workplace tooling rather than new enterprise systems, with analytics and AI components tied into service management and user experience telemetry. Governance is structured around the five year contract term with phased rollouts and centralized performance monitoring through the application s analytics capabilities, and process restructuring focused on service desk workflows and device lifecycle governance to meet stated sustainability objectives. The program description emphasizes transformation of service desk and digital workplace services without specifying outcomes beyond the stated aims of improved service quality, agility and environmental sustainability.
